Frequently asked questions

About Sussex Elementary
How many students attend Sussex Elementary?
Sussex Elementary enrolls approximately 430 students in grades PK-05.
Is Sussex Elementary an elementary, middle, or high school?
Sussex Elementary is an elementary school covering grades PK-05.
What is the student-teacher ratio at Sussex Elementary?
The student-to-teacher ratio at Sussex Elementary is approximately 14.8:1 (29 FTE teachers).
What is the student diversity at Sussex Elementary?
Student demographics at Sussex Elementary are roughly 37% White, 25% Hispanic, 27% Black, 1% Asian, 9% Two or more.
What district is Sussex Elementary in?
Sussex Elementary is part of Baltimore County Public Schools.
